Wastewater: From Waste to Resource - The Case of Arequipa, Peru
Core Content
The case study of Arequipa, Peru, highlights a successful public-private partnership (PPP) that transformed wastewater from a pollutant into a valuable resource. The initiative, known as La Enzolada, is a wastewater resource recovery facility designed to treat and reuse municipal sewage for industrial and agricultural purposes.
Main Points
Context and Challenges
- SEDAPAR S.A. is a public service enterprise in Arequipa, providing water and sanitation to over 1.1 million people with more than 94% water coverage and 80% sanitation coverage.
- Arequipa Department is vast (63,345 km²), arid, and has deep valleys and high mountains, making water infrastructure development challenging.
- The Chili River, a key water source for the region, was heavily polluted due to untreated wastewater from Arequipa city, which threatened both the environment and public health.
- Cerro Verde, the largest copper mine in Peru, needed additional water for its expansion but faced challenges due to the region's water scarcity and poor wastewater treatment capacity.
Proposed Solution
- La Enzolada is a water resource recovery facility designed, financed, built, and operated by Cerro Verde under a PPP agreement with SEDAPAR.
- The facility treats wastewater from Arequipa city and reuses it for mining operations (1 m³/second) while returning the rest to the Chili River for downstream agricultural use.
- The plant uses trickling filters, which are more energy-efficient than activated sludge, especially at high altitudes (over 2,000 meters above sea level).
Financial Structure
- Cerro Verde financed the CAPEX (capital expenditure) and OPEX (operating expenditure) of the project, including the wastewater treatment plant, pumping station, and conveyance pipelines.
- The project was structured over 29 years, with ownership and management transferred to SEDAPAR at the end of the contract.
- SEDAPAR saved over $615 million by not having to build and operate the wastewater treatment plant itself, with savings of $538 million in construction and $77 million in operation and maintenance.
Benefits
- Environmental Benefits: Improved water quality in the Chili River, reduced pollution, and the return of aquatic life.
- Social Benefits: Reduction in waterborne diseases, better health for downstream communities, and improved irrigation for farmers.
- Economic Benefits: Cost-effective water supply for Cerro Verde compared to alternatives like desalination, which would have cost at least four times more.
Stakeholder Engagement
- Continuous engagement with local and regional stakeholders was crucial for the project's success.
- Cerro Verde implemented a community relations program and collaborated with a multisectoral water users' committee.
- The company has contributed to other water infrastructure projects, including the Bamputañe dam, Pillones dam, and La Tomilla II potable water plant.
Key Information
- La Enzolada started operations in December 2016 and has a current capacity of 1.8 m³/second, with plans for two future expansions to 2.1 m³/second (2029) and 2.4 m³/second (2036).
- The PPP agreement allowed Cerro Verde to take on most of the project risks, including technical, financial, and operational, which were deemed less costly than not expanding the mine.
- The cost per cubic meter of water via La Enzolada is $0.68–$0.80, significantly lower than the $2.5/m³ for desalination and pumping.
- Some farmers expressed dissatisfaction due to reduced water availability for irrigation, leading to ongoing discussions on compensation.
Lessons Learned
- Stakeholder engagement is essential for the success of water reuse projects, especially in communities affected by water source changes.
- Favorable national PPP regulations can encourage private sector participation in innovative waste-to-resource projects.
- Water scarcity can drive the economic viability of wastewater reuse, particularly in regions where alternative water sources are expensive or inaccessible.
- Mitigating social risks is a complex challenge that requires inclusive dialogue and compensation mechanisms for affected groups.
Conclusion
The La Enzolada project exemplifies how well-structured PPPs can address both business and social needs. It demonstrates the potential of wastewater reuse to improve environmental quality, public health, and water security in water-scarce regions. The collaboration between Cerro Verde and SEDAPAR has led to significant economic and social benefits, while also setting a precedent for future waste-to-resource initiatives.
